In City of Pittsburgh v. Federal Power Comm., 1956, 99 U.S.App.D.C. 113, 237 F.2d 741, we reviewed the Commission's authorization to Texas Eastern Transmission Corporation to (1) abandon the Little Inch pipeline as a natural gas facility, thereby making it available for transportation of petroleum products, and (2) construct substitute facilities.
